350 people watched a beauty contest. Some paid GH¢20.00 each while others paid GH¢30.00 each. The total amount collected was GH¢8,800.00. Find how many paid the two different rates.

Answers

Answer: 170 people paid GH¢20 and 180 people paid GH¢30

Step-by-step explanation:

Let the number of people that paid GH¢20 be represented by x.

Let the number of people that paid GH¢30 be represented by y.

Based on the above information given, we can form an equation which will be:

x + y = 350 ....... i

20x + 30y = 8800 ....... ii

Multiply equation i by 20

20x + 20y = 7000 ...... iii

20x + 30y = 8800 ...... iv

Subtract iii from iv

10y = 1800

y = 1800/10

y = 180

Since x + y = 350

x = 350 - y.

x = 350 - 180

x = 170

Therefore, 170 people paid GH¢20 and 180 people paid GH¢30

Write the equation of the line that is perpendicular to y=2x-7 and passes through the point (6, 5)
A. y=2x-2
B.y= -1/2x+8
C.y=-1/2x-8
D.y=2x=2

Answers

Answer:

B

Step-by-step explanation:

we are given a equation of a line

we want to figure out the equation of the perpendicular line passes through the (6,5) points

in order to do so

recall that,

[tex] \displaystyle m_{ \text{perpendicular}} = - \frac{1}{m} [/tex]

we got from our given equation that m=2

because equation of a line is y=mx+b

thus

[tex] \displaystyle m_{ \text{perpendicular}} = - \frac{1}{2} [/tex]

remember that, when we want to figure out perpendicular line or parallel line we should the formula given by

[tex] \displaystyle y - y_{1} = m(x - x_{1})[/tex]

since we got our perpendicular m is -½, [tex]x_1=6[/tex] and [tex]y_1=5[/tex], substitute

[tex] \displaystyle y - 5 = - \frac{1}{2} (x - 6)[/tex]

to get the perpendicular equation you should simplify the above equation to y=mx+b form

distribute -½:

[tex] \displaystyle y - 5 = - \frac{1}{2} x + 3[/tex]

add 5 to both sides:

[tex] \displaystyle y = - \frac{1}{2} x + 8[/tex]

hence,

our answer choice is B
